There was a woman. She looked like Axel’s wife. Then she changed, and she didn’t anymore. She still looked beautiful though. She had golden hair, like gold that had been turned to fine thread. Her eyes were the same color, and mystical. Her eyes pulled him in, so much so that he almost missed the little patches of gold, orange, and red jewel-like stones beneath her eyes. They were like jewels, stuck to her skin. In the form of a sort of eyeshadow.
He was so enthralled however, that he did not care about them more than that. He decided to think of them as exotic jewelry, even though it was clear they were embedded in the skin.
The woman approached him, walking across the marble floor of the heavenly palace they stood inside. She was dressed in a gown of sunset red and yellows, and all over her were pieces of gold and silver jewelry. The jewelry pieces were set with all kinds of beautiful gems and precious things. Diamonds, rubies, pearls, beryl, red and yellow sapphires, and many others.
He did nothing, no, he could do nothing, as she reached and touched a hand to his cheek. She was just a bit taller than him, and stood with a regal poise that reminded him of the time he had met the Queen of Aericia - but this woman was many times more beautiful. In fact, he had only ever seen one person so alluring and divine. That had been the Paladin’s wife - the Lady Fallenstar, the fourth star, Eir. He had just caught a glimpse of her, and she had been like this, but with great silver feathered wings upon her back.
“Do you know who I am?” she said, and though she spoke softly her voice was powerful. “Do you know what I am?”
Axel did not need to think, and he did not think. Instead, he answered, almost as if it were an involuntary response. “You are Sitari, the sun. You are the second star, the angel of love, of passion, and of parenthood. You are she that created the dragons, and she that destroyed them. You bless the crops and bring the spring. ”
“Yes.” she said, and smiled upon him warmly. He felt overjoyed that she was pleased with him. He felt tears forming at his eyes. “Do you know why I am here?”
“No my lady, no I do not.” he replied.
“To tell you to go. To save you. But not just you. Convince the girl that she must leave. Let her go from this place. Your foe is too powerful for you both. I watched from the horizon, as I fell from the heavens, and I wished to warn you.” she said. “I must go now, for my time in the day is over. However, I shall be with you. Convince the girl. Convince her to leave. If you cannot get her to leave, you must do so by force. You must kill her.”
Axel listened carefully, and his mind did not waver when she issued the command. There was a small part of him, a logical part, that told him that the last thing she said it did not make sense with everything else she had just said, but the logical part did not win out. Soon, the edges of his vision became black, as he tried to nod and shout a reply. However, Sitari did not respond, and soon the whole of the vision had faded to darkness.

In the darkness he heard crying. It was a mournful wailing. It was terrible, like someone had just had a loved one or a dear pet die. He strained to open his eyes, and slowly but surely he did.
The world was white all around him, and lit by a flickering light. He was laying on his side, and when he was rolled over to look around he felt pain shoot from one of his arms. He looked down at it and noticed that it was wrapped up in a sling. Once he was on his other side, and no longer facing a wall of snow, he could see his surroundings.
He was inside of a small little cave of ice and snow. Inside of it, just a feet feet away, was Ezmeralda. She sat near a fire, and beside her was something mangled. For a moment, Axel thought it was some sort of animal, but a terrible realization hit him when he recognized the form as human. It was Rolf, laying in a pool of thick cold blood, and all his limbs in the wrong direction. Part of the him was burnt, and the sobbing he had heard was Ezmeralda crying over him.
Or rather, she was sobbing over a corpse. Axel new better than to think the boy was still alive.
“Ezmeralda.” he said, and she perked up momentarily.
“Are you- are you...are you alive?” she asked. Her face was contorted in sorrow, and tears streamed down from here eyes.
“Yes.” he said, and coughed as he did so. It was hard to speak, and his chest hurt. “What happened?”
“I- I stopped the avalanche.” she said. Then her words started to stutter so severely Axel could not understand her.
“Slow down.” he said.
“I tried to stop the avalanche, but the blast of my magic hit Rolf, and then he was scooped up by the snow. I stopped the worst of it form hitting you.” she said, forcing herself to speak deliberately and slowly.
“You...you stopped an avalanche?” he asked.
“Yes.” she replied, firmly.
“How?” he asked.
“Because I am blessed. I am exalted.” she said. Axel had heard those words before. They referred to individuals like the were beasts that answered to Rana, the moon, or to men like the Paladin. Many mythical creatures as well, such as the elves, vampires, dragons, and more.
“By whom.” he said.
“By Sitari.” Ezmeralda replied.
“How? Why?” he asked, as the vision he had just had flooded into his memory. Of course Stiari would be watching this girl, if this girl were one of her blessed children. So much also made sense now.. This was why she had not died in the cold. This was how she had recovered so fast. This was why she never really tired, but acted like it.
“Because one of her disgusting creatures, a dragon, killed my family. They destroyed everything I love. And she, who walks the earth like a human to this day, showed up to late to stop them.” Ezmeralda said. “She gave it to me as a payment, or rather, I tricked her into giving it.”

Tricked? Tricked a celestial, one of the divine? Impossible, and if so, terrible. Unforgivable. An undeserved anger began to build in Axel towards Ezmeralda, and he remembered the words of the sun goddess in his vision.
“A dragon? You’ve been taking us to fight a dragon?” he asked in disbelief. His mind was a fog between the words he was saying and the thoughts in his mind. The fact that Rolf was dead was still hitting him, and the sadness was starting to overtake all of his other thoughts. Still, Sitari’s words stayed in his mind.
“Yes. It probably caused this avalanche.” Ezmeralda said, as she tried to collect herself from crying.
“Why didn’t you tell us? Why didn’t you say anything? Why didn’t you call for help from the-”
“Do you think anyone would listen to me!?” she cried. Then her tone changed, and her face changed from contorted sadness to anger, and then back to sadness “And I didn’t want help. I didn’t want other people suffering and dying to this monster. I told you not to help me. I tried to get away from you! I even - I even tried to run away in the night, but Rolf got up and caught me. I - I told him I was just going to pee and then - and then I…and then I came back because I wanted to talk with him…I suppose he would have just tracked me down anyway, if I’d run. You all would probably think I got lost…he didn’t deserve this. He was trying to help me. He was trying to help me and got too close because of it.”
As the girl rambled, Axel became more angry. “This was about revenge, wasn’t it?! That is what all this was about?!”
“Of course!” she screamed. “Of course it was about revenge. I wanted to kill that monster with my own hands. To deal with it as it dealt with me! Otherwise it would just stay up in these mountains forever again, and then…and then someday it would kill the next person that bitch comes and gives her favor to.”
“What do you mean?” Axel asked, now confused. He was still angry, and Sitaris words were fresh in his mind, but he hesitated against acting on them. He wanted to kill Ezmeralda at this point. She had done a horrible evil in not telling them the truth, in holding back her secret just so that she alone would be able to exact revenge on this beast. If he had known, he would have sent word to Verum, and had an army of paladins, and their lord himself, come to the north.
At the same time, his wisdom overcame the drug like urge to hurt the girl, and the thought of what his daughter would think if her father became a man who had killed someone out of revenge ; stayed him form launching into an attack.
“Sitari, the sun.” Ezmeralda said. “She’s horrible, so horrible. She made these greedy jewel loving, trickster, murderous lizards. She gave them their fire and their illusions. She acts like its not her fault too. And these aren’t even the first. She made Sukarram what it is today. She almost caused the apocalypse because she was too afraid to kill her own children. Read it, its history. Her love is a fire, and it burns anyone who gets to close to it, and it has burnt this world.”
Axel paused. “Do they like jewelry, because she does?”
Ezmeralda’s tears stopped, and she raised an eyebrow at him. “She doesn’t where jewelry.”
“Really?” he asked, now confused, as he remembered the figure from his dream.
“They like gold and jewels because those things are closer to divinity, like their mother, posses divine aspects, and remind them of their mother’s brilliance. Its vanity too. The dragon that attacked my village had red scales, like rubies.” she said. “It is like a child putting on their parent’s clothes. Some dragons have other interests. Its just whatever they associate with riches, power, and the divine. Whatever flatters them.”
“Ezmeralda.” Axel said. “Can dragons change their form?”
Ezmeralda nodded quickly. “Yes. Their illusions are so powerful they become reality, and the give up their true form. Its called shying. It isn’t perfect though, there are always issues, like scaling patches, horns, wings. That sort of thing. Why are you asking these questions? Did you…did you see anything while you were out?”
Axel struggled to say what he said next, as if his mind had been swayed against talking about the vision. “Yes. I think, I think I did. I saw this beautiful golden haired woman. She was dressed in this fine gown.”
“That sounds like Sitari.” Ezmeralda said. “She has golden hair, and eyes. Did this person also have wings like sunset?”
Axel shook his head. “No. She wore all these jewels, and she-”
“That is the dragon.” Ezmeralda replied, curtly. “She’s trying to get inside your head. What did she do, tell you to kill me or something?”
“Yes.” Axel said, and he felt a tinge of pain as he did so. It must have been some sort of enchantment, he concluded, and fighting it had caused him to feel pain. After that though ,the thoughts and feelings he’d had disappeared, and it felt terrible to have even thought about hurting Ezmeralda.
“Well then, lets go and kill her.” Ezmeralda replied. Then with that, she turned and put her hand to the wall over their shelter, and began to melt her way out of the place.
